A complete KitCo Schools kit that includes a deck of Talents, a deck of Values and a deck of Emotions; a printed guide with games and activities; a sheet on the function of each basic emotion; a sheet on the types of talents; an anti-stress ball to establish the speaking order, and a card with a QR code to access KitCo Digital, with downloadable support resources and online activities.
A practical and comprehensive tool to expand skills vocabulary, develop emotional literacy and work on self-awareness, emotional expression, coexistence and personal and academic guidance.

The facilitator poses a question, the group chooses images or concepts, shares what they see, and turns the discovery into a decision or action.
A question appropriate to the objective and the age.
Images help us think without searching for "the right answer".
Each person explains their choice and listens to other perspectives.
The group finalizes a learning, agreement, or next step.
